How Weave and Texture Design Enhance Portable Plastic Beach Mat Safety

Importance of Weave and Texture Design

A Portable Plastic Beach Mat is widely used for outdoor activities, providing a comfortable surface on sand, grass, or rocky terrain. While portability and durability are key features, the mat’s weave and surface texture play a critical role in preventing slipping and edge curling. Understanding how these design factors impact stability and user safety is essential for both manufacturers and consumers.

Role of Weave Density

  1. Weight distribution: A tightly woven mat evenly distributes weight across the surface, reducing localized stress that can cause slipping.
  2. Structural integrity: Dense weaves enhance mat stiffness, helping it maintain shape under the pressure of movement or multiple users.
  3. Edge reinforcement: Proper weaving near edges prevents curling and fraying, keeping the mat flat and secure during use.

Surface Texture and Slip Resistance

  1. Raised patterns: Textured surfaces or small ridges create friction between the mat and feet, improving grip on wet or sandy surfaces.
  2. Anti-slip coatings: Some mats incorporate UV-resistant or rubberized coatings within the weave to enhance traction further.
  3. Directional texture: Patterns that run in multiple directions reduce the risk of sliding in any direction, enhancing overall stability.

Preventing Edge Curling

  • Thicker borders: Reinforced edges or hemmed borders prevent curling caused by folding, rolling, or environmental factors like wind.
  • Integrated anchoring points: Holes or loops at the corners allow stakes or pegs to secure the mat, preventing displacement and edge lifting.
  • Structural balance: Combining flexible center areas with reinforced edges maintains comfort while reducing the likelihood of curling under repeated folding or storage.

Material Considerations and Flexibility

  1. Plastic type: High-density recycled plastics resist bending or warping, which helps maintain a flat surface and prevents edges from curling.
  2. Flexibility vs. stiffness: Flexible mats are easy to roll and carry, but too much flexibility can cause instability. A balanced structure ensures portability while retaining anti-slip performance.
  3. UV and moisture resistance: Materials designed to resist sun exposure and moisture help maintain both texture and weave integrity over time, preserving anti-slip properties.

Environmental and Usage Factors

  1. Sand and moisture interaction: Textured surfaces trap small grains of sand, increasing friction and reducing slipping risk.
  2. Wind and terrain: Mats with denser weaves and reinforced edges are less likely to shift on uneven ground or in windy conditions.
  3. User behavior: Placing mats correctly and using optional anchoring features improves the benefit of weave and texture designs, ensuring consistent stability.

Maintenance and Longevity

  • Regular cleaning: Removing sand, salt, or debris prevents abrasion that can smooth textures and reduce friction.
  • Proper storage: Rolling or folding the mat along the designated lines preserves edge structure and prevents curling.
  • Periodic inspection: Checking edges and corners for fraying or wear allows timely repair or replacement, maintaining anti-slip performance over time.
